The literary works agrees that, offered the variety of individuals with serious mental disease, it is necessary to keep a variety of feasible housing alternatives that serve this population. Adhering to is a listing of the a lot more typical housing versions available in communities today: Established by state-run programs, someone receiving supported housing will live individually in a community facility, either on the open market (such as an apartment or condo), or in a non-profit or cooperative organization.
The resident is not limited on the length of time he/she is allowed to stay, which gives security and a feeling of home. Citizens of supported real estate devices are appointed an instance manager to assist them with daily living. The major distinction between this version and encouraging housing (see below), is that assistance services are offered from outside the home, normally by a different company than the managment of the domestic center.
Residents can remain in supported real estate as long as they desire. Tsemberis (2003) reported that homeowners of sustained real estate, when compared to citizens of supportive real estate and area residences, were one of the most satisfied overall with their circumstances One issue pointed out by residents in supported real estate is the capacity for solitude and seclusion, since there is no "ready-made community", such as what exists in clubhouses or team homes.
